A swag of new results from over 20,000m of drilling at Peel Mining’s Wirlong deposit have opened the door for a new resource update at its emerging South Cobar copper project.

The latest results from Peel Mining’s (ASX:PEX) resource drilling at Wirlong, which included 38 holes for 20,813m of drilling across three rigs that began in April, have continued to demonstrate its high grade copper potential.

Mineralisation remains open along strike and down plunge of the Wirlong resource, which includes 2.45Mt at 2.4% copper and 8.7g/t silver for 57,900t copper metal and 686,000oz of precious silver.

Assays for 22 holes have been returned with 16 pending. Their receipt will be the trigger for an upgrade of the South Cobar Project resource, incorporating Wirlong and Mallee Bull Copper deposits and Southern Nights-Wagga Tank Polymetalic deposit.

Here come the numbers

Results from recent drilling include some stand our hits by width and grade, including:

  • 16m at 3.01% Cu, 5g/t Ag from 613m (WLDD060W1)
  • 7m at 1.51% Cu, 4g/t Ag from 480m and 11m at 1% Cu, 3g/t Ag from 499m (WLDD060W2)
  • 14m at 1.16% Cu, 9g/t Ag from 264m and 48m at 1.4% Cu, 2g/t Ag from 573m (WLDD061)
  • 17m at 1.1% Cu, 9g/t Ag from 265m including 4.37m at 2.47% Cu, 14g/t Ag from 276m (WLDD061W1)
  • 23.05m at 2.1% Cu, 8g/t Ag from 267.95m including 3.83m at 6.01% Cu, 23g/t Ag from 281.79m (WLDD063)
  • 40.75m at 1.04% Cu, 4g/t Ag from 266.25m including 10m at 2.93% Cu, 12g/t Ag from 275m (WLDD063W1).

Other, narrower hits included 3m at 6.83% copper and 21g/t silver from 473m in hole WLDD064W1.

Significant deposit

Peel CEO Jim Simpson noted the results confirmed Wirlong as a significant part of the South Cobar Project.

It stands alongside the 2017 Mallee Bull resource, also due for update with the benefit of new drilling, which includes 6.76Mt indicated and inferred resources at 1.8% copper, 31g/t silver, 0.4g/t gold, 0.6% lead and 0.6% zinc for a 2.6% copper equivalent grade.

“The latest phase of infill and extensional drilling at Wirlong has now concluded, allowing Peel to progress to an updated resource for the South Cobar Project,” Peel Mining CEO Jim Simpson said.

“Results to date confirm the quality of the Wirlong copper deposit and that Wirlong will be a significant component of our South Cobar Project.

“The significance of the infill drilling should not be understated as it has improved our confidence and understanding of the structural controls and geometry of mineralisation.

“The completion of this drilling also allows us to move to exploration decline design and permitting with greater confidence.“
